Couples glide across the floor, strangers move together and glasses clink between bites of food.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s like therapy\u201d, one patron laughed, as a sound that has shaped Ghanaian life for generations fills the space.<\/p>\n<p>The charged atmosphere has taken on fresh meaning after Ghana\u2019s famed Highlife music was recently inscribed on Unesco\u2019s Intangible Cultural Heritage list. The agency announced the decision on December 10, calling Highlife a \u201cmonumental expression of Ghana\u2019s musical genius, culture and global influence\u201d.<\/p>\n<p>For Asah Nkansah, leader of Kwan Pa \u2014 meaning \u201cthe right path\u201d \u2014 the timing is symbolic.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If you trace the origin of Highlife, it goes back to September 1925\u201d, he said. \u201cSo in 2025, we are celebrating 100 years of Ghanaian Highlife music\u201d.<\/p>\n<p>At Zen Garden, the century-old tradition feels anything but distant. Palm-wine-infused sets trigger spontaneous dancing, with patrons singing lyrics from memory deep into the night.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cHighlife talks about everything \u2014 love, passion, social life\u201d, Nkansah said. \u201cIt has content. It\u2019s not music for music\u2019s sake\u201d.<\/p>\n<p>Unesco\u2019s listing places Highlife among the world\u2019s protected cultural treasures, highlighting a genre that has influenced hiplife and Afrobeats; and shaped Ghana\u2019s identity for more than a century.<\/p>\n<p>Back at Zen Garden, as midnight nears, the crowd shows no sign of leaving.
